Product reviews:
Leonard
2025-03-18 iphone 11 Pro
Amazon.com: Disney Donald Duck Plush donald duck stuffed animal
donald duck stuffed animal
Tyler
2025-03-12 iphone 6s Plus
9\ donald duck stuffed animal
donald duck stuffed animal
Sebastian
2025-03-13 iphone 7 Plus
Donald Duck Stuffed Animal donald duck stuffed animal
donald duck stuffed animal